A greeting can be recorded locally by the Attendant or, when defined as a CCR destination,
from a remote location. In the latter case, the CCR Table must include the Remote Record
destination. The caller may then use the remote access procedure to record a greeting.
Operation
To record System Greetings from Attendant;
1. Press the [TRANS/PGM] button and dial ‘0 6’.
2. Dial the desired announcement number (001 ~ 070). The recording instruction
“Press the # key to record.” plays followed by any previous recording for the
announcement.
3. Dial ‘#’ and start recording after the beep, or to record external music dial ‘*’ to hear
the external source then ‘#’ to record external music
4. Press the [HOLD/SAVE] button to stop and store the recording.
To delete a System Greetings from Attendant,
1. Press the [TRANS/PGM] button.
2. Dial the code ‘0 6’.
3. Dial the appropriate message number, the recording is played.
4. Press the [SPEED] button while the message is playing.
To record a greeting from remote CCR access;
1. Dial the digit assigned for Remote record access in the CCR Table.
2. Dial the System Attendant Authorization code
3. Dial the System Greeting number (00~70) and follow the recording instructions
4. Dial ‘#’ to start recording.
5. Press the ‘#’ to save the recording
Consideration
Pressing the [On/Off] button while recording, will stop and store recording the recording.
System Greetings and prompts can be recorded at the System Attendant or can be
downloaded to the system in the maintenance mode.
There is no time limit for an individual System Greeting or prompt.
To record or delete a System Greeting or prompt, all the VMIB ports must be idle state.
When a call is transferred to an Attendant, the ‘Transfer to Attendant’ prompt followed by
ring-back tone is presented to the caller.
If a System Greeting or prompt is not recorded, tone will be heard.
The VMIB can maintain 800 messages including user greetings, voice messages, and
two-way recordings.
If a recording exceeds the VMIB memory capacity, recording is terminated and the
previous recording, if any, is stored.
The System Attendant must have VMIB Access enabled to record a greeting or prompt.
